VanLiere, Donna

Summary: 1950 Tennessee, a time and place that straddles past and present. Ivorie Walker is considered an old maid by the town (though she's only in her early thirties). She takes that label with good humor and a grain of salt, hiding her loneliness behind a fierce independence. When she realizes that a dirty-faced boy has been stealing vegetables from her garden, Ivorie can't imagine his desperation....
